Trash Folder
A dedicated space in a digital environment where deleted files are temporarily stored before permanent deletion.
Operating System
The basic software that handles the administration of computer hardware and software resources while supplying general services for computer software.
Internal Hard Drive
A storage device located inside a computer that stores all the software, data, and information of the system.
Launchpad Button
An interface element that provides quick access to a collection of applications or tools in a user's device or operating system.
